Spring and Summer Hours

The following press release was published by the U.S. Department of the Interior, National Park Service on May 2, 2014. It is reproduced in full below.

Spring visitor center hours will be in effect at Theodore Roosevelt National Park beginning on Saturday, May 3, 2014.The South Unit Visitor Center is open daily 8:00 a.m. to 4:30 p.m. MDT.The North Unit Visitor Center, at the entrance to Juniper Campground, is open on Saturdays and Sundays 9:00 a.m. to 5:30 p.m. CDT.The Painted Canyon Visitor Center will open for the season on Saturday, May 3. Hours will be 9:00 a.m. to 4:30 p.m. MDT.

Summer hours will begin on Sunday, June 1. The North Unit Visitor Center will be open daily 9:00 a.m. to 5:30 p.m. CDT. The South Unit Visitor Center will be open daily 8:00 a.am. to 6:00 p.m. MDT and Painted Canyon Visitor Center will be open daily 8:30 a.m. to 6:00 p.m. MDT.
